The claim we’re evaluating

Regular mechanical plaque control, particularly frequent tooth brushing, reduces plaque, calculus, and gingivitis in dogs; current evidence does not establish that specific home dental interventions improve canine lifespan or prevent long-term systemic disease.

Nara’s interpretation

Nara considers routine dental hygiene a well-supported foundation for canine oral health. Randomized canine trials show meaningful reductions in plaque, calculus, and gingivitis, with frequent brushing generally outperforming less intensive home methods. Nara does not currently interpret these findings as evidence that home dental care extends lifespan or prevents systemic disease.

This is an umbrella assessment. The evidence differs materially depending on the outcome and the specific form of the intervention, so Nara evaluates those narrower claims separately.

What is known

Controlled canine trials demonstrate that frequent tooth brushing reduces plaque accumulation and gingivitis and that daily brushing can outperform dental chews or dental diets for plaque control. Periodontal disease is common in veterinary populations, and observational studies have reported associations between periodontal and systemic disease. Those prevalence and association data do not demonstrate that treating plaque prevents systemic disease, major morbidity, or death.

What is not known

Most intervention trials are short and evaluate dental indices rather than years-long tooth retention, pain, systemic disease, healthspan, or survival. Evidence differs substantially between brushing, dental diets, chews, water additives, professional scaling, and treatment of established periodontal disease. Periodontal prevalence estimates depend heavily on examination method and clinical-record ascertainment. Associations between periodontal disease and systemic disease are vulnerable to shared risk factors and do not establish causality. Evidence supporting professional diagnosis or treatment of established disease should not be collapsed into evidence for owner-directed home prevention.
